    Question DBRE - Null pointer

    Hi,

    I have setup a oracle database and updated the database.properties to point to the database.

    When i run database reverse engineer, i get this

    dbre roo> database reverse engineer --schema app --package ~.entity
    NullPointerException at org.springframework.roo.addon.jdbc.polling.interna l.PollingJdbcDriverManager.findAddOnsOffering(
    PollingJdbcDriverManager.java:73)

    Thanks

    These dependencies (from addon-jdbc) are required for Oracle:
    Code:
    		<dependency>
    			<groupId>com.oracle.jdbc</groupId>
    			<artifactId>com.springsource.oracle.jdbc</artifactId>
    			<version>10.2.0.2</version>
    		</dependency>
    		<dependency>
    			<groupId>javax.resource</groupId>
    			<artifactId>com.springsource.javax.resource</artifactId>
    			<version>1.5.0</version>
    			<scope>provided</scope>
    		</dependency>
    		<dependency>
    			<groupId>javax.transaction</groupId>
    			<artifactId>com.springsource.javax.transaction</artifactId>
    			<version>1.1.0</version>
    			<scope>provided</scope>
    		</dependency>
    However, I don't like the NPE and will look at this

    Unless your Oracle 11 db driver is OSGi-enabled, it's not going to work as Roo runs in an OSGi container.

    With the dependencies I listed above in my Maven repo, I have tested Oracle XE (10) quite successfully, so I am not sure what to tell you.

    I added null checks for OBR-related client calls. Though it may not solve your issue, at least you shouldn't get NPEs anymore. Please see ROO-1277.

    I wanted to ask earlier if you were both connected to the Internet when the error occurred? The issue you experienced can be caused by not having a connection.
